Сегодня 04 марта 2026
18+
MWC 2018 2018 Computex IFA 2018
реклама
Видеокарты

Методика тестирования видеокарт 2007. Использование FRAPS.

⇣ Содержание

В чем таится мощь FRAPS

Сейчас мы покажем вам, где искать необходимое нам количество значений FPS. По завершении тестирования замечательная утилита FRAPS создает еще один файл - « … frametimes.csv».
 fear1280-frametimes.gif
Здесь все просто. Числа слева – порядковый номер кадра, справа – время в миллисекундах, прошедшее с начала теста. Именно здесь и кроется самое важное! Чтобы было понятно, дополним эти столбцы еще двумя, как показано ниже.
 frametimes-calc.gif
Два столбца слева мы оставили в прежнем виде. А вот насчет двух других стоит поговорить поподробнее. Столбец frametime получен из столбца time следующим образом – для каждого кадра (строки в таблице) мы из текущего значения времени вычли предыдущее. Таким образом, значения в столбце frametime показывают, сколько времени рендерился (рисовался) каждый кадр. Ну а дальше просто, осталось только преобразовать это в привычные значения FPS. Из времени рендеринга кадра легко получить мгновенное значение FPS – для каждого frametime в таблице надо взять обратную величину, и умножить ее на 1000 (поскольку время у нас в миллисекундах). Таким образом, получаем четвертый столбец, содержащий мгновенные значения FPS для каждого кадра! Вернемся к нашим тестам F.E.A.R. Как легко подсчитать, использование в качестве источника данных файла « … frametimes.csv» дает уже не 53 отсчета значений FPS, а уже порядка 3000 отсчетов (продолжительность теста в секундах умножить на средний FPS). А с таким объемом данных работать уже интереснее.
 fear-graph-detailed.gif
Посмотрите, как преобразился первоначальный график зависимости FPS, вся его «тонкая структура» прекрасно проявилась. Видны как резкие взлеты мгновенных значений FPS, так и провалы. Давайте попробуем вычислить минимальное и среднее значение FPS на обновленном объеме данных. В итоге средний FPS получается равным не 59, как показывает встроенный тест, а даже 75.36. Приятно видеть возросший FPS, но ведь условия тестирования не изменились! С минимальным FPS все ровно наоборот. Вместо 30, как было, мы имеем всего лишь 11,97 FPS. А это значит, что будут «лаги». Ну а что покажет диаграмма распределения FPS?
 fear-diagram-detailed.gif
Вид диаграммы изменился не так разительно, разве что она стала немного «плотнее» и детальнее. Видно, что основная масса мгновенных значений FPS все так же расположена в диапазоне от 30 до 70 и образует «основной колокол», а вообще все это напоминает спектр радиосигнала – несущая частота с полезным сигналом (определенной ширины) плюс более высокие гармоники. Конечно, «колокол» распределения далеко не идеальный, но уже что-то. Кстати, если отбросить все значения FPS выше 70-ти и подсчитать среднее, то получим, что средний FPS будет равен 45.1, что довольно близко к предыдущему значению 42.8. Как видите, даже встроенный тест FEAR оказывается далеко неоднозначным к способу вычисления итогового результата. Какой же из них «достовернее» - 42.8, 45.1, 59 или 75 FPS? Мне лично кажется, более достоверным является значение 42,8 FPS. Такое оно, без самообмана. А теперь давайте посмотрим, что же будет, если мы по такой же методике попробуем обработать результаты в NFS Most Wanted.

Следующая страница → ← Предыдущая страница
⇣ Содержание
Если Вы заметили ошибку — выделите ее мышью и нажмите CTRL+ENTER.

window-new
Soft
Hard
Тренды 🔥
OpenAI обновила модель для стандартных ответов в ChatGPT на более прямолинейную GPT 5.3 Instant 6 ч.
Google переведёт Chrome на двухнедельный цикл выпуска обновлений 7 ч.
«МойОфис» стал доступен частным пользователям бесплатно, но с обидными ограничениями 7 ч.
Сотрудники Google и OpenAI призывают к ужесточению ограничений на использование ИИ в военных целях 7 ч.
Заряженное ностальгией музыкальное приключение Mixtape от создателей The Artful Escape не заставит себя долго ждать — дата выхода и новый трейлер 10 ч.
Разработчики амбициозного авиасимулятора «Корея. Серия Ил-2» раскрыли план на 2026 год — вылет состоится по расписанию 11 ч.
Головокружительный трейлер подтвердил дату выхода Denshattack! — безумного платформера про неподвластный гравитации поезд 12 ч.
Просыпайся, самурай: первую волну мартовских новинок Game Pass возглавила Cyberpunk 2077 13 ч.
Драйвер Nvidia 595.71 WHQL ограничил ручной разгон у GeForce RTX 50-й серии 13 ч.
Meta начала тестировать платформу для ИИ-поиска товаров 13 ч.
Китайской BYD удалось обойти Tesla в статусе крупнейшего поставщика электромобилей в 22 странах и регионах мира 2 ч.
Новая статья: Обзор Infinix NOTE 60 Pro: смартфон с двумя экранами 5 ч.
Ayar Labs привлекла $500 млн инвестиций от AMD, NVIDIA, MediaTek и др. 6 ч.
Разработан инструмент для поиска дефектов нанометровых транзисторов — отладка техпроцессов пойдёт веселее 7 ч.
Новая статья: Обзор материнской платы MSI MAG X870E GAMING PLUS MAX WIFI: собираем на Zen 5 сегодня, присматриваемся к Zen 6 — завтра 7 ч.
«Байкал Электроникс» поставит компании «Реглаб» 1,5 млн чипов Baikal-U — ими заменят микропроцессоры STMicroelectronics 7 ч.
TCL заменила LCD на AMOLED в линейке смартфонов Nxtpaper, выжав флагманскую яркость без бликов 7 ч.
В США представили прообраз «жёсткого диска» на ДНК с упрощёнными процедурами записи и чтения 10 ч.
В России число базовых станций LTE растёт, а 3G — уменьшается 10 ч.
Представлены обновлённые MacBook Pro 14 и 16 — дисплеи Liquid Retina XDR, больше памяти и до 30 % быстрее 11 ч.